Understanding the Importance of Due Diligence

Think of Bitcoin hedge fund due diligence like checking the ingredients label before buying food. Just as you wouldn’t want hidden additives in your meal, you shouldn’t invest in a fund without knowing its risks. It’s essential to verify a hedge fund’s operations, its track record, and the management team’s expertise.

Assessing Regulatory Compliance

Consider cryptocurrency regulation akin to traffic laws in a city—without them, chaos ensues. Countries like Singapore are paving the way for clearer DeFi regulations by 2025, which will shape how hedge funds operate. Investors should ensure that the fund adheres to these laws, mitigating operational risks.

Identifying Management Transparency

Imagine purchasing a car without knowing its maintenance history; you’d likely avoid that deal. Similarly, transparency in hedge fund management is vital. Investors should seek clear communication regarding the fund’s strategy, holdings, and performance. This openness helps build trust and encourages informed investment decisions.
